Review

The Goodman 2.5-ton gas furnace and air conditioner system sits squarely in the practical middle ground of residential HVAC. With 60,000 BTU heating and 30,000 BTU cooling capacity, this horizontal A-coil configuration fits homes between 1,200 and 1,600 square feet. It's built on the Goodman nameplate, which contractors trust for serviceability and parts availability across North America.

Performance numbers are genuinely strong for the price point. The furnace delivers 97% AFUE efficiency using modulating burners that adjust flame automatically, cutting energy waste compared to older on-off models. The air conditioner earns 13 SEER with R454B refrigerant and a variable-speed ECM blower that ramps output to match actual load. At 73 dB, operation is reasonable for a single-stage unit. Maximum airflow reaches 1,200 CFM, supporting both heating and cooling in tight ductwork scenarios.

Installation

Installation is straightforward for licensed contractors familiar with Goodman systems. The unit accepts 3/8 inch liquid and 3/4 inch suction lines with sweat valve connections. Electrical demands are minimal, requiring 115V single-phase 60Hz power with a 16.7 to 25-amp breaker. Upflow/horizontal mounting accommodates both basement and attic placement. Plastic PVC exhaust venting simplifies retrofits where metal flue isn't available.

Warranty & Reliability

Goodman includes a 10-year parts warranty when you register online at purchase. This covers compressor, heat exchanger, and major components, giving peace of mind through the critical reliability window. Registration is simple and extends protection compared to the base 1-year coverage. It's solid but not exceptional compared to some competitors offering 12-year terms.

Frequently Asked Questions

Is 13 SEER competitive for a 2.5-ton unit in 2024? +
Yes. While 14 SEER and higher exist, 13 SEER still qualifies for ENERGY STAR and delivers meaningful savings over older 10-11 SEER equipment. Single-stage design keeps cost reasonable while maintaining efficiency.
Can this system handle a tight ductwork retrofit? +
Yes. The variable-speed ECM blower adjusts to available ductwork resistance, and maximum 1,200 CFM is manageable in constrained spaces. Contractors appreciate flexibility without expensive redesigns.
How does 97% AFUE compare to older furnaces? +
Dramatically better. A 20-year-old furnace typically runs 78-82% AFUE. This 97% unit recovers nearly all heat from combustion, reducing annual fuel consumption by 15-20% for comparable heating loads.
Does this compete with two-stage systems? +
No. Single-stage cooling cycles on and off rather than modulating output. Two-stage systems provide better dehumidification and temperature stability but cost more. This works fine in moderate climates.
Is R454B refrigerant a long-term choice? +
Yes. EPA approved for new equipment and will be standard through 2030s. Contractors are building familiarity. Supply chains are now established across major markets.
